Abstract(s)
As economias dos mais diversos países são em grande parte sustentadas pelas pequenas
e médias empresas (PMEs), no entanto, na grande maioria dos casos os recursos que
dispõem são limitados. Logo, as empresas, especialmente as Pequenas e Médias
Empresas (PMEs) têm que cada vez mais procurar formas de se sobressaírem no meio
onde se inserem, ou seja, no setor onde se encontram, de forma a conseguirem ganhar
uma vantagem competitiva.
Assim, as ações de melhoria pensadas pelas empresas têm que ser cada vez mais
estruturadas, planeadas e apoiadas por toda a organização, para que as mesmas tenham
o sucesso desejado na sua implementação. Desta forma, o objetivo deste relatório
consiste no mapeamento e elaboração de processos, utilizando fluxogramas, para que se
possa estabilizar os mais diferentes processos e, assim, se consiga diminuir a quantidade
de erros e consequentemente aumentar a qualidade.
A metodologia utilizada para aprofundar os conhecimentos sobre as temáticas em
questão foi a pesquisa bibliográfica. Para este propósito foram utilizadas as seguintes
bases de dados: a Web of Science, Science Direct, Emerald, Scopus, IEEE Xplore e a
Emerald.
O trabalho desenvolvido permite atingir uma maior estabilização dos processos e um
maior conhecimento dos mesmos por parte dos funcionários, para que, desta forma, seja
possível alcançar uma menor quantidade de erros na produção e, consequentemente,
maiores níveis de qualidade dos processos. De realçar que, o trabalho em causa permite
uma melhor e mais eficiente comunicação, uma vez que, com o mapeamento e a definição
apropriada dos processos os fluxos de informação também ficam definidos. Por fim, para
a implementação bem-sucedida do trabalho desenvolvido é necessário o apoio e
colaboração de todas as pessoas envolventes dos mais diferentes níveis hierárquicos.
The economies of the most diverse countries are largely supported by Small and Medium-sized Enterprises (SMEs), however, in the vast majority of cases the resources they have are limited. Therefore, companies, especially small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) have to increasingly look for ways to stand out in the environment where they operate, that is, in the sector where they are located, in order to gain a competitive advantage. Thus, the improvement actions designed by companies have to be increasingly structured, planned and supported by the entire organization, so that they have the desired success in their implementation. In this way, the objective of this report is to map and elaborate processes, using flowcharts, so that the most different processes can be stabilized and, thus, be able to reduce the number of errors and consequently increase quality. The methodology used to deepen the knowledge about the themes in question was the bibliographical research. For this purpose, the following databases were used: Web of Science, Science Direct, Emerald, Scopus, IEEE Xplore and Emerald. The work carried out allows achieving greater stabilization of the processes and a greater knowledge of them by the employees, so that, in this way, it is possible to achieve a smaller number of errors in production and, consequently , higher levels of process quality. It should be noted that the work in question allows for better and more efficient communication, since, with the mapping and appropriate definition of processes, information flows are also defined. Finally, for the successful implementation of the work carried out, the support of all the people involved at different hierarchical levels is necessary.
